No adverse credit but unable to get credit

Hi, I regularly check my credit file and have alerts set with the 2 main credit reference agencies, there is no negative info on there such as missed/late payments etc, I’ve been at my address for 3 years, on electoral role, homeowner, employed, a couple of credit cards etc. So in theory I should be a lenders ideal customer but nobody will give me any credit except the high rate credit cards, all I want to do is extend my mortgage so iv made a couple of ‘soft’ applications with existing mortgage lender and declined, I then made a soft search for a car loan and again declined. I’ve been very careful not to make full applications to avoid damaging my score further - any ideas what is wrong ?
